Definition of forest

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of forest is as below...

Forest (a.) Of or pertaining to a forest; sylvan.

Rata :: Rata (n.) A New Zealand forest tree (Metrosideros robusta), also, its hard dark red wood, used by the Maoris for paddles and war clubs..
Opening :: Opening (n.) A thinly wooded space, without undergrowth, in the midst of a forest; as, oak openings..
Timber :: Timber (n.) Woods or forest; wooden land.
Frith :: Frith (a.) A forest; a woody place.
Disboscation :: Disboscation (n.) Converting forest land into cleared or arable land; removal of a forest.
Herbage :: Herbage (n.) The liberty or right of pasture in the forest or in the grounds of another man.
Aurochs :: Aurochs (n.) The European bison (Bison bonasus, / Europaeus), once widely distributed, but now nearly extinct, except where protected in the Lithuanian forests, and perhaps in the Caucasus. It is distinct from the Urus of Caesar, with which it has often been confused..
Midst :: Midst (n.) The interior or central part or place; the middle; -- used chiefly in the objective case after in; as, in the midst of the forest..
Thwaite :: Thwaite (n.) Forest land cleared, and converted to tillage; an assart..
Chiminage :: Chiminage (n.) A toll for passage through a forest.
Glade :: Glade (n.) An open passage through a wood; a grassy open or cleared space in a forest.
Disforestation :: Disforestation (n.) The act of clearing land of forests.
Thin :: Thin (superl.) Not close; not crowded; not filling the space; not having the individuals of which the thing is composed in a close or compact state; hence, not abundant; as, the trees of a forest are thin; the corn or grass is thin..
Inhabit :: Inhabit (v. t.) To live or dwell in; to occupy, as a place of settled residence; as, wild beasts inhabit the forest; men inhabit cities and houses..
Forest :: Forest (n.) An extensive wood; a large tract of land covered with trees; in the United States, a wood of native growth, or a tract of woodland which has never been cultivated..
Plant :: Plant (n.) To furnish, or fit out, with plants; as, to plant a garden, an orchard, or a forest..
Wilderness :: Wilderness (v. t.) A tract of land, or a region, uncultivated and uninhabited by human beings, whether a forest or a wide, barren plain; a wild; a waste; a desert; a pathless waste of any kind..
Purlieu :: Purlieu (n.) Originally, the ground near a royal forest, which, having been unlawfully added to the forest, was afterwards severed from it, and disafforested so as to remit to the former owners their rights..
Agistment :: Agistment (n.) Formerly, the taking and feeding of other men's cattle in the king's forests..
Deforest :: Deforest (v. t.) To clear of forests; to disforest.
